Output d7bbfe68f67099b522bc7d48dcee0d9db56b2f29228ee0032a8aa079f46217ce:55

value
65467838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83e907bd8cf5a29a21a41498b7aed63ae931cba OP_EQUAL
address
3QKcTAgRHReoKm8dJTm17AB5QsRWxZ9Xyv
transaction
d7bbfe68f67099b522bc7d48dcee0d9db56b2f29228ee0032a8aa079f46217ce
spent
true